Affordable Housing Scheme
Affordable homes are properties made available at a discount to the price that would normally be paid if the house was bought on the open market. Affordable homes are provided on the basis that you will live in the property and not use it for any other purpose.
Do I qualify for an affordable home?
To qualify there are some basic criteria you must meet:
- You must be a first time buyer (but they are some exceptions, for example if you are divorced)
- You must have enough income to meet your mortgage repayments after you have paid all your other costs;
- You must be registered with your local authority
How do I get started? You will need to get in contact with your Local Authority who will provide you with an application form and details of the affordable homes available in your area. A useful website to check out is www.affordablehomes.ie. Once you have registered with the Local Authority to qualify for a home you will need an approval in principle from a lender.
